Position Summary
The Pharmacy Intake Innovation team is a dynamic group within Retail Store Operations, focused on supporting business needs and retail colleagues while upholding regulatory and compliance standards. We are passionate about designing innovative solutions that improve workflows and enhance the colleague experience.
As a Manager, Pharmacy Intake Innovation, you will play a key role in identifying and implementing solutions to address business challenges. You will collaborate across departments to drive interoperability through the adoption of ePrescribing standards and support strategic initiatives with data-driven insights. This role requires a strong collaborator and influencer with a growth mindset and a passion for continuous improvement.
Primary Role Responsibilities:
Tactical Project Execution
- Collaborate on the creation and execution of strategic roadmaps.
- Execute project plans with minimal supervision.
- Partner with cross-functional teams including IT, Legal, Regulatory, and Product Development.
- Communicate project plans, risks, and opportunities to leadership.
Field Support & Communication
- Assist in writing field communications and managing communication touchpoints.
- Create field-facing materials for leadership meetings and conferences.
- Support the development of effective communication strategies for new programs.
Analytics & Insights
- Evaluate reporting and analysis to support progress tracking and decision-making.
- Translate data into actionable insights to inform business strategies.
Required Qualifications
- 5+ years of experience in a retail and/or corporate environment.
- Proven ability to influence without authority and inspire teams.
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to derive insights from data.
- Excellent communication skills-both written and verbal.
-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ines.
- High level of personal integrity and sound judgment.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ook.
- Ability to travel, up-to-25%, based on business needs.
Preferred Qualifications
- 8+ years of experience in a retail and/or corporate environment.
- Knowledge of change management techniques.
- Lean Six Sigma certification or knowledge.
- Expertise in NCPDP ePrescribing standards.
- Knowledge in Gen AI and Machine Learning.
Education
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
